i just DL Vlc because doesnt that allow you to play AVI files? and also now that i have it DL do i have to do anything for it to start workin, like apply a setting or will it just work? a little confused what i do with VLC? any help would be amazing

Well, what you have downloaded is called the installer.exe of the player. You'll have to double click it and then it will start to install itself. Then just follow the installation and click ok where desired and/or necessary.
Afterwards you can try and open a media file either by trying to double click a media file 9which should actually open the VLC player) or by right clicking a media file and then choosing "Open with...">"VLC player"....
